An additive approach to nonlinear degree of discrete function
Prikladnaâ diskretnaâ matematika, no. 2 (2010), pp. 22-33
An additive approach to the definition of the nonlinearity degree of a discrete function is proposed. For elementary abelian groups, this notion is equivalent to ordinary “multiplicative” one. As a consequence we obtain the method for describing a stabilizer groups of a $p^m$-valued function in the transition groups.
